+Subject: bpf: fix incorrect tracking of register size truncation
+Origin: https://git.kernel.org/linus/0c17d1d2c61936401f4702e1846e2c19b200f958
+Bug-Debian-Security: https://security-tracker.debian.org/tracker/CVE-2017-16996
+
+Properly handle register truncation to a smaller size.
+
+The old code first mirrors the clearing of the high 32 bits in the bitwise
+tristate representation, which is correct. But then, it computes the new
+arithmetic bounds as the intersection between the old arithmetic bounds and
+the bounds resulting from the bitwise tristate representation. Therefore,
+when coerce_reg_to_32() is called on a number with bounds
+[0xffff'fff8, 0x1'0000'0007], the verifier computes
+[0xffff'fff8, 0xffff'ffff] as bounds of the truncated number.
+This is incorrect: The truncated number could also be in the range [0, 7],
+and no meaningful arithmetic bounds can be computed in that case apart from
+the obvious [0, 0xffff'ffff].
+
+Starting with v4.14, this is exploitable by unprivileged users as long as
+the unprivileged_bpf_disabled sysctl isn't set.
+
+Debian assigned CVE-2017-16996 for this issue.
